Abstract

This study investigates the treatment of conflict situations of an intercultural nature in the professional framework of tour guides. Intercultural competence is considered not sufficiently studied within the framework of the postgraduate improvement of the language for professional purposes in the Cuban tourism sector. The objective is focused on developing a didactic-methodological conception and the creation of a conceptual framework towards the development of intercultural competence in tour guides, by making use of the theory of mediation. The article focused on a new definition of intercultural competence and analyzed some reflections on the creation of a conceptual platform to evaluate this competence. In the development of this study, the conceptual model of the Macro Intercultural Competence Coping is presented, suitable to base the intercultural components through the treatment of conflict situations. Its application will facilitate a greater awareness of the characteristics of one’s own culture, the reactivation of cultural knowledge and the development of critical thinking for mediation in conflict situations.
